A corner grounded power system is a system that is fed from a delta transformer winding with one phase grounded. A 3D model WattNode meter, with the appropriate voltage range, will correctly measure grounded delta services, but the measured voltage and power for the grounded phase will be zero and the status LED will not light, because the voltage is near zero. For the best accuracy with a grounded delta service, you should connect the N (neutral) terminal on the meter’s green screw terminal block to the meter’s ground terminal and then connect the ground terminal to the electrical service safety ground. Corner-Grounded Delta System A system in which the transformer secondary is delta-connected with one corner of the delta solidly grounded. You can determine if you have a corner grounded delta service by using a multimeter (DMM) to measure the voltage between each phase and ground.
